Motorola Moto Edge 30 Neo Screen Replacement

Screen Replacement guide for the Motorola Moto Edge 30 Neo

Moderate
~52 min
22 steps

Before you begin

Tools

  • Precision screwdriver set
  • Plastic opening tools
  • Suction cup
  • Heat gun or hairdryer
  • Tweezers
  • SIM eject tool
  • Spudger

Parts / materials

  • Pre-cut display adhesive strips
  • Back panel adhesive
  • Isopropyl alcohol (90%+)
  • Lint-free cleaning cloth

Safety

  • Wear safety glasses to protect your eyes from small glass fragments.
  • Disconnect the battery before touching internal components to prevent electrical shorts.
  • Do not puncture or bend the lithium-ion battery during the repair.

Step-by-step

  1. 1

    Power off device

    1 min

    Turn off your Moto Edge 30 Neo completely before starting the repair.

  2. 2

    Remove SIM card tray

    1 min

    Insert a SIM eject tool into the hole on the frame to pop out the tray.

  3. 3

    Heat back cover edges

    3 min

    Apply heat from a heat gun along the outer edges of the rear panel for two minutes to soften the adhesive.

  4. 4

    Attach suction cup

    1 min

    Press a suction cup firmly onto the lower portion of the back cover.

  5. 5

    Slice back cover adhesive

    4 min

    Pull up on the suction cup and slide a plastic opening pick along the edges to slice the adhesive.

  6. 6

    Lift off back cover

    2 min

    Carefully separate the rear panel from the frame once the adhesive is cut.

  7. 7

    Unscrew upper midframe

    3 min

    Remove the Phillips screws securing the plastic motherboard cover.

  8. 8

    Pry off motherboard cover

    2 min

    Use a spudger to gently pop up and remove the motherboard bracket.

  9. 9

    Disconnect battery flex

    1 min

    Pry the battery cable connector straight up from the motherboard to cut power.

  10. 10

    Disconnect display flex cable

    1 min

    Use a plastic opening tool to disconnect the display connector from the board.

  11. 11

    Heat front display

    3 min

    Warm the front glass with a heat gun for 2-3 minutes to loosen the screen adhesive.

  12. 12

    Attach suction cup to screen

    1 min

    Place the suction cup near the bottom edge of the glass screen.

  13. 13

    Insert pick under screen

    2 min

    Pull the suction cup upward and insert an opening pick into the seam between the glass and frame.

  14. 14

    Slice screen perimeter adhesive

    5 min

    Guide the pick slowly around all four edges of the display to break the seal.

  15. 15

    Remove broken display assembly

    2 min

    Carefully lift the display away while threading the flex cable out of the frame slot.

  16. 16

    Clean frame residue

    5 min

    Scrape off residual adhesive and broken glass from the frame using tweezers and isopropyl alcohol.

  17. 17

    Apply new screen adhesive

    4 min

    Lay down fresh adhesive strips along the internal rim of the metal frame.

  18. 18

    Install replacement display

    3 min

    Feed the screen flex cable through the chassis slot and seat the new screen into the frame.

  19. 19

    Reconnect display flex

    1 min

    Align and press the display flex connector onto its mainboard socket.

  20. 20

    Reconnect battery flex

    1 min

    Press the battery connector down onto the motherboard until it snaps into place.

  21. 21

    Secure motherboard cover

    3 min

    Place the top plastic bracket back in position and reinsert all Phillips screws.

  22. 22

    Reseal back cover

    3 min

    Apply perimeter adhesive to the rear cover and press it firmly against the frame to seal.

After your Motorola Moto Edge 30 Neo screen replacement

Power the Moto Edge 30 Neo back on and test the screen replacement function before you put every screw away. Check touch/display response, charging, cameras, buttons, and wireless as relevant to this repair. If something fails after closing the device, reopen carefully and reseat the connectors for this Motorola Moto Edge 30 Neo job before assuming the part is defective. Keep leftover adhesive and screws labeled in case you need a second pass.
